1. everydrop® by Whirlpool Refrigerator Water Filter A – EDRARXD1 (Pack of 1)
Rating: 9.4/10
The everydrop® by Whirlpool Refrigerator Water Filter A – EDRARXD1 (Pack of 1) keeps your refrigerator’s water pure and refreshing. This filter is the only one approved by major brands like Whirlpool, Maytag, Amana, KitchenAid, and Jenn Air. It works hard to remove up to 74 different impurities, including harmful things like lead, pesticides, and even some medicines. You can trust that it meets high safety standards, as it’s certified by NSF/ANSI Standards 42, 53, and 401. Getting clean water from your fridge is now super simple thanks to a clever twist-and-lock design that makes changing the filter a breeze. Remember to swap out your filter every six months for the best taste and performance.

3. GE XWFE Refrigerator Water Filter
Rating: 9.0/10
Keep your GE refrigerator’s water and ice tasting fresh and clean with the GE XWFE Refrigerator Water Filter. This genuine replacement filter is designed to fit specific GE french-door refrigerators and works hard to remove many common water impurities, giving you peace of mind with every sip.
What We Like:
- GE GUARANTEED FIT: It’s made specifically for certain GE french-door refrigerators, so you know it will work.
- PREMIUM FILTRATION: This filter is certified to reduce lead, sulfur, chlorine-resistant cysts, and over 50 other impurities, making your water taste better.
- PHARMACEUTICALS REDUCTION: It can reduce select pharmaceuticals like ibuprofen and ibuprofen, which is an extra layer of filtration.
- BUY WITH CONFIDENCE: It’s certified by NSF/ANSI standards, meaning it meets strict requirements for drinking water treatment.
- EASY FILTER REPLACEMENT: You don’t need any tools or to turn off your water to change it. It’s a quick and simple process.
- SIX-MONTH FILTER LIFE: For the best results, you should replace the filter every six months or after 300 gallons of use.
- XWFE REPLACES XWF: If your refrigerator used the XWF filter, this XWFE filter is a direct and compatible replacement.

5. AQUA CREST 5 Years Capacity -Inline Water Filter for Refrigerator with 1/4-Inch Direct Connect Fittings
Rating: 8.9/10
The AQUA CREST 5 Years Capacity Inline Water Filter is a versatile solution for cleaner, better-tasting water. It easily connects to refrigerators, ice makers, RVs, and more, offering long-lasting filtration. This filter is designed to reduce common contaminants, making your water safer and more enjoyable.
What We Like:
- Wide Range of Uses: You can use this filter in many places like refrigerators, ice makers, coffee makers, RVs, boats, and even RO systems. It fits most major refrigerator brands, so you likely won’t have compatibility issues.
- Super Easy to Install: Setting up this filter is a breeze. It comes with everything you need, including fittings for different types of water lines. You can install it quickly without needing to cut any tubing.
- Long-Lasting Filtration: This filter lasts for an amazing 5 years or 5,000 gallons! That means you get great-tasting water for a very long time without needing frequent replacements, saving you money.
- Effective Filtration: It uses a special activated carbon block to reduce chlorine, PFAS, PFOA/PFOS, and other impurities. This greatly improves the taste and smell of your water, making it refreshing.
- Safe Materials: The filter is made from BPA-free and lead-free materials, so you can be confident that the water you drink is safe.
- Complete Package: The filter comes with all the necessary tubing and fittings, so you have everything you need right out of the box.
What Could Be Improved:
- Doesn’t Reduce TDS: It’s important to know that this filter will not reduce the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) in your water. If that’s a concern for you, you might need a different type of filter.

Key Features to Look For
1. Filter Type and Location
- Internal Filters: These are hidden inside the fridge. They’re neat and don’t stick out.
- External Filters: These are visible on the outside, usually at the top. They are often easier to change.
- Filter Lifespan: Check how long a filter lasts. Most last for about six months or 300 gallons.
- Filter Indicator Light: This light tells you when it’s time to change the filter. It’s super helpful!
2. Refrigerator Size and Style
- French Door: These have two doors for the refrigerator and a freezer drawer below. They are popular and offer good storage.
- Side-by-Side: The fridge and freezer are next to each other. They are good for narrow kitchens.
- Top-Freezer: The freezer is on top, and the fridge is below. These are often the most affordable.
- Counter-Depth: These fridges sit flush with your cabinets for a built-in look.

Important Materials
Most refrigerators are made of stainless steel or a similar metal. Stainless steel looks nice and is easy to clean. Some have plastic interiors for shelves and drawers. The water filter itself is usually made of activated carbon. This material traps impurities in the water.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: How often do I need to change the water filter?
A: You usually need to change the filter every six months or after filtering about 300 gallons of water. Always check your fridge’s manual.
Q: Where can I buy replacement filters?
A: You can buy them online, at appliance stores, or sometimes at big box stores.
Q: Will the filter affect the taste of my water?
A: Yes, it should make the water taste better by removing impurities like chlorine.
Q: Do all refrigerators with water filters come with an ice maker?
A: Not always, but most do. It’s a common feature.
Q: Are the filters expensive?
A: The cost can vary, but they are usually a worthwhile investment for clean water.
Q: Can I use generic filters instead of the brand name?
A: Some people do, but it’s best to check if your fridge manufacturer recommends specific filters for best performance and warranty.
Q: How do I know if my fridge has a water filter?
A: Look for a water dispenser on the door, and check the inside of the fridge for a filter compartment. Your manual will also tell you.
Q: Does the filter clean the ice too?
A: Yes, the water used to make ice is also filtered.
Q: What happens if I don’t change the filter?
A: The filter will stop working effectively, and the water may not be as clean. The water flow might also slow down.
Q: Is it hard to change the water filter?
A: Most filters are designed to be easy to change. They often just twist or click into place.
